Nick Jones Posted March 13, 2019 Report Share Posted March 13, 2019 So when you fit vented discs and space your callipers to match, the pad retaining pins become too short. Longer ones are not supplied in the “conversion kit”. What is the standard method for getting around this? I have the earlier callipers with 1/4” pins so buying the pins for the vented M16 (Granada and 2.8 Capri) won’t work.....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
GT6M Posted March 13, 2019 Report Share Posted March 13, 2019 Mek yer own Nick, either brass rod,or stainless, drill a wee wol in each end, and fit some R clips https://www.ebay.co.uk/itm/R-Clip-To-Fit-Brake-Pad-Pin-Retainer-4-PACK-Large/181570538183?hash=item2a46728ac7:g:s~UAAOSwA~VaBFHk simples really, its wot I did,when the original mild steel type rotted away M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Clive Posted March 14, 2019 Report Share Posted March 14, 2019 It it not worth drilling the callipers to accept the metric pin? Then no hassle fitting decent pads of your choice.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
johny Posted March 14, 2019 Report Share Posted March 14, 2019 I believe the metric pin is smaller diameter than the imperial one so drilling the callipers no help....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
